How to Make Feta Cheese Dressing at Home

Making your own feta cheese dressing is easy and can be done with just a few ingredients. To make a basic dressing, mix together feta cheese, olive oil, lemon juice, and a pinch of salt and pepper. For a creamier dressing, add in some plain Greek yogurt or sour cream. You can also customize the flavor by adding in herbs such as dill, parsley, or basil. Serve over your favorite salad or as a dipping sauce for vegetables or pita chips.

How to Store Feta Cheese Dressing

To store feta cheese dressing, transfer it to an airtight container and refrigerate for up to one week. Before using, give the dressing a quick stir or shake to mix any separated ingredients back together. Avoid leaving the dressing out at room temperature for extended periods of time, as this can increase the risk of bacterial growth.

Nutritional Values of 1 Oz Feta Cheese Dressing

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)156 kcal
Fat (g)16.8 g
Carbs (g)0.62 g
Protein (g)1.18 g

Calorie breakdown: 95% fat, 2% carbs, 3% protein
